2014 Peugeot 508 I RXH (Phase II, 2014) 2.0 HDi (200 Hp) Hybrid Automatic | Specifications


Internal combustion engine specs

Coolant 10 l
Engine Model/Code RHC DW10CTED4
Engine aspiration Turbocharger, Intercooler
Engine configuration Inline
Engine displacement 1997 cm3
Engine layout Front, Transverse
Engine oil capacity 5 l
Engine systems Particulate filter
Fuel injection system Diesel Commonrail
Number of cylinders 4
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Power 163 Hp
Power per litre 81.6 Hp/l

Dimensions

Front track 1592 mm
Height 1521 mm
Length 4828 mm
Rear (Back) track 1564 mm
Wheelbase 2815 mm
Width 1864 mm

Electric motor power 37 Hp

System power 200 Hp @ 3750 rpm.
System torque 450 Nm @ 1750 rpm.

General information

Body type Crossover
Brand Peugeot
Doors 5
End of production 2018 year
Generation 508 I RXH (Phase II, 2014)
Model 508
Modification (Engine) 2.0 HDi (200 Hp) Hybrid Automatic
Powertrain Architecture FHEV (Full Hybrid Electric Vehicle)
Seats 5
Start of production 2014 year

Performance specs

Acceleration 0 - 100 km/h 8.8 sec
Acceleration 0 - 60 mph 8.4 sec
Acceleration 0 - 62 mph 8.8 sec
CO2 emissions 104 g/km
Emission standard Euro 5
Fuel Type Diesel
Fuel consumption (economy) - combined 4 l/100 km
Fuel consumption (economy) - extra urban 4.1 l/100 km
Fuel consumption (economy) - urban 3.8 l/100 km
Maximum speed 213 km/h
Weight-to-power ratio 8.9 kg/Hp, 113 Hp/tonne
Weight-to-torque ratio 3.9 kg/Nm, 254.2 Nm/tonne

Drivetrain, brakes and suspension specs

Assisting systems ABS (Anti-lock braking system)
Drive wheel All wheel drive (4x4)
Front brakes Ventilated discs
Front suspension Independent, type McPherson with coil spring and anti-roll bar
Number of gears and type of gearbox 6 gears, automatic transmission
Rear brakes Disc
Rear suspension Independent multi-link suspension
Steering type Steering rack and pinion
Tires size 245/45 R18 93V; 225/55 R17 93V
Wheel rims size 18; 17

Space, Volume and weights

Fuel tank capacity 70 l
Kerb Weight 1770 kg
Max load 555 kg
Max. weight 2325 kg
Trunk (boot) space - maximum 1360 l
Trunk (boot) space - minimum 400 l

The VIN number, also known as the VIN code, is the vehicle identification number. VIN is an abbreviation of the English term Vehicle Identification Number. The VIN number is a unique set of 17 characters that car manufacturers assign to all vehicles they produce. The VIN code can be found on various parts of the car body or in the registration documents.
